Taiwan Outshines South Korea in Asia’s 2024 Stock Market Performance

SEOUL, Dec. 25 (Korea Bizwire) — Taiwan’s stock market has emerged as the top performer among Asia-Pacific’s major indices in 2024, while South Korea’s benchmark Kospi index lags near the bottom, weighed down by domestic and global challenges. Korean Manufacturing and Exports Face Mounting Challenges Amid Global and Domestic Uncertainty

SEOUL, Dec. 23 (Korea Bizwire) — South Korea’s manufacturing and export sectors, the backbone of its economy, are bracing for significant challenges in early 2025 due to rising global trade tensions and domestic political instability. Gov’t to Inject Additional ‘Value-up Funds’ Worth 300 Bln Won into Stock Market

SEJONG, Dec. 23 (Korea Bizwire) — The government is set to swiftly deploy additional market stabilization measures, including the injection of the second phase of value-up funds worth 300 billion won (US$207 million) into the country’s stock market, Finance Minister Choi Sang-mok said Monday. South Korea’s Potential Growth Rate Expected to Drop Below 2%, Raising Economic Concerns

SEOUL, Dec. 20 (Korea Bizwire) – South Korea’s potential growth rate is projected to fall below 2% next year, signaling challenges for the nation’s long-term economic sustainability, according to a report released by the Bank of Korea (BOK) on December 19. N. Korea-linked Hackers Stole US$1.34 Billion from Crypto Platforms This Year: Chainalysis

WASHINGTON, Dec. 19 (Korea Bizwire) — Hackers linked to North Korea stole more than US$1.3 billion from crypto platforms this year, marking the largest ever annual amount that they have raked in from hacking activities, a report from a blockchain analysis firm showed Thursday.
